Output 2e68f741834dedc7e6bd7cb72e994dee8486132895244a1a9abb1fec62e496c5:23

value
851566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cd9336ec3ed4c89f7c34384db83d387f91b7306 OP_EQUAL
address
3BcZ6eNZtypyHdPRRXDfHbzkiP2V3ChmvV
transaction
2e68f741834dedc7e6bd7cb72e994dee8486132895244a1a9abb1fec62e496c5
spent
true